在当今的企业管理中,审批流程的效率直接影响着企业的运营效率。高效、透明的审批流程不仅能提升员工的工作体验,还能降低管理成本。本文将深入探讨如何通过前端代码实现高效审批流程,为您的企业带来全新的管理体验。
一、审批流程概述
首先,让我们来了解一下审批流程的基本概念。审批流程是指在企业内部,对某一事项或项目进行审核、批准的过程。它通常包括以下几个环节:
- 提交申请:员工提交审批申请。
- 审批流转:申请在各个审批节点流转。
- 审批决策:审批人根据申请内容做出决策。
- 结果反馈:将审批结果反馈给申请人。
二、前端技术在审批流程中的应用
前端技术在审批流程中扮演着至关重要的角色。以下是一些前端技术在审批流程中的应用:
1. 用户界面(UI)设计
一个直观、易用的用户界面是高效审批流程的基础。以下是一些UI设计原则:
- 简洁性:界面简洁,避免冗余信息。
- 一致性:保持界面元素的一致性,提高用户体验。
- 响应式设计:适应不同设备和屏幕尺寸。
2. 前端框架
使用前端框架可以加快开发速度,提高代码质量。以下是一些流行的前端框架:
- React:适用于构建动态、高性能的用户界面。
- Vue.js:易于上手,具有丰富的生态系统。
- Angular:由Google维护,功能强大。
3. 数据交互
前端与后端的数据交互是审批流程的关键。以下是一些数据交互技术:
- RESTful API:一种轻量级、无状态的API设计风格。
- GraphQL:一种更灵活、强大的数据查询语言。
三、前端代码实现审批流程
以下是一个简单的审批流程前端代码示例,使用React框架:
import React, { useState } from 'react';
const ApprovalProcess = () => {
const [status, setStatus] = useState('待审批');
const handleApprove = () => {
setStatus('已批准');
};
const handleReject = () => {
setStatus('已拒绝');
};
return (
<div>
<h1>审批流程</h1>
<p>当前状态:{status}</p>
<button onClick={handleApprove}>批准</button>
<button onClick={handleReject}>拒绝</button>
</div>
);
};
export default ApprovalProcess;
四、总结
通过前端代码实现高效审批流程,可以帮助企业提高管理效率,降低运营成本。在设计和开发过程中,关注用户体验、选择合适的前端框架和数据处理技术至关重要。希望本文能为您在审批流程前端开发方面提供一些启示。
